  • Ron Rockwell Hansen arrested for spying for China

    According to MSN, Ron Rockwell Hansen was arrested as a spy for China in Hong Kong on Saturday. Hansen is a former US Army warrant officer and case officer for the Defense Intelligence Agency.

    Mr. Hansen, 58, a fluent Mandarin speaker who first visited China in 1981, has allegedly received at least $800,000 in “funds originating from China” since May 2013.

    On Saturday, Mr. Hansen was arrested in Seattle and charged with attempted espionage, in what appears to be another high-profile mole hunt by F.B.I. investigators intent on uncovering Chinese spying against the United States.

    “His alleged actions are a betrayal of our nation’s security and the American people and are an affront to his former intelligence community colleagues,” John C. Demers, the assistant attorney general for national security, said in a statement posted on the Justice Department’s website on Monday.

    If convicted, Mr. Hansen faces a maximum penalty of life in prison. He is also accused of “acting as an unregistered foreign agent for China, bulk cash smuggling, structuring monetary transactions and smuggling goods from the United States,” the Justice Department said.

    From BBC;

    He is alleged to have attempted repeatedly to regain access to classified information after he stopped working for the US government, thereby alerting authorities to his actions.

  • Raymond Jaquay; flag thief needed curtains

    Raymond Jaquay; flag thief needed curtains

    According to CBS News, Raymond Jaquay stole flags from various memorials in Pennsylvania and when investigators caught up to him, Jaquay explained that he needed curtains;

    Raymond Jaquay is accused of stealing U.S. and POW/MIA flags from sites in western Pennsylvania including Brackenridge Memorial Park, and a Marine Corps flag from an ice cream shop in Tarentum, according to CBS Pittsburgh. Police identified Jaquay through surveillance video from a nearby business and arrested him on June 2.

    When officers went to his home, they found the flags. When asked why he stole the flags, police say Jaquay told them a curtain rod in his home broke and he needed something to cover his windows, CBS Pittsburgh reports.

    Jaquay has since apologized and returned all of the flags.

    The Brackenridge community spent years raising money to restore the war memorial and on Memorial Day, residents held a special rededication ceremony. Shortly after the ceremony, the flags went missing.

    None of his victims want to press charges against Jaquay, but he is facing charges for disorderly conduct from local constabulary.

  • Jose Alvarez-Marrero; another kind of phony vet

    Jose Alvarez-Marrero; another kind of phony vet

    Reb and Thundrstixx send us a link to the story of Jose Alvarez-Marrero in Hialeah, Florida who was neutering dogs with no real training;

    Alvarez-Marrero, 58, faces three counts of practicing veterinary medicine without a license and animal cruelty with an intent to injure or kill and was booked into Turner Guilford Knight Correctional Center.

    Hialeah police learned of the illegal makeshift veterinary practice inside the couple’s apartment on East 50th Street after Omarnestor Delrio took his 12-year-old American bulldog, Royalty, to Alvarez-Marrero and Gonzalez to be neutered on April 23.

    He had brought his pets to Alvarez-Marrero before.

    After several procedures, Royalty was in such bad shape that Delrio took him to a Knowles Animal Clinic in Miami. There, a vet told him the neutering procedure on the dog “was beyond medical malpractice.” It was, the police report said, “pure animal cruelty.”

    Royalty died on April 30.

  • Fake cops in Flint, Michigan

    Fake cops in Flint, Michigan

    According to MLive, about ten people calling themselves the Genesee County Fire and EMS Media-Genesee County Task Force Blight Agency have been pretending to be law enforcement officers for about three years in Flint, Michigan – pretend-arresting and detaining people with their pretend uniforms and pretend police car.

    Leyton authorized charges against three people on Wednesday, May 30, that include three counts of unlawful imprisonment and one count of impersonating a peace officer to commit a crime.

    Emily Nicole Burrison, 27, of Burton, and Jeffrey Lee Jones, 29, of Flint, were arraigned on the charges Thursday, May 31, before Genesee District Judge David Goggins.

    A third Flint man was charged in connection with the case and he was taken into custody while working at Cedar Point in Ohio. Investigators said he is being held at the Erie County Jail while awaiting extradition to Genesee County for arraignment on the charges.

    Court records indicate there are five other co-defendants in the case, however, charges have not yet been filed against them.

    Police say that there were times that the pretend cops arrived on the crime scenes ahead of legitimate first responders.

    [Kevin Shanlian, chief of the Genesee County Parks ranger division] said there was a core group of about 10 people who were impersonating police since October 2015.

    “I believe there’s probably hundreds of victims who were actually detained and didn’t have good experiences with these folks,” Shanlian said.

  • Rachel Dolezal faces felony charges

    Rachel Dolezal faces felony charges

    Rachel Dolezal, the woman who pretended to be a Black woman is now looking at felony charges for welfare fraud, perjury and false verification for public assistance according to Fox News;

    The charges against Dolezal, who changed her name to Nkechi Diallo in October 2016, were first reported by KHQ-TV.

    According to court documents, investigators with Washington state’s Department of Social and Health Services (DSHS) started looking into Dolezal’s finances in March 2017 after the publication of her autobiography, “In Full Color: Finding My Place in a Black and White World.”

    DSHS investigator Kyle Bunge said Dolezal had claimed that “her only source of income was $300.00 per month in gifts from friends.” However, the department found that she had deposited nearly $84,000 in her bank account between August 2015 and September 2017 without reporting it.

  • Clayton Pressley III sentenced again

    Clayton Pressley III sentenced again

    Last year, we talked about Clayton Pressley III, a former sailor when he was sentenced for identity theft of his subordinate sailors. He got 50 months in prison for that. It seems that while investigators dug into that charge, they discovered that there was a larger plot afoot according to the Virginian-Pilot;

    The Bronze Star recipient was also ripping off the Navy through an elaborate procurement fraud scheme.

    Pressley was sentenced Tuesday to two years in federal prison in connection with the $2.3 million fraud. That is on top of four years and two months he received in the identity theft case, in which he fraudulently obtained $24,000 in loans.

    The fraud charges stem from Pressley’s efforts in 2014 to manipulate the Navy’s procurement process for personal profit. According to court documents, Pressley, then a senior chief petty officer, and unnamed co-conspirators were selling Navy “inert training aids,” or fake bombs, that were never shipped but marked as delivered.

    According to court documents, an unnamed Navy officer who had purchasing authority ordered the aids from two vendors, identified as Firm D and Firm V.

    Friendly sales representatives from those firms funneled orders to Firm G, a Tucson, Ariz.-based business that served as a front for Pressley, the mother of one of his children and other co-conspirators. No goods were ever delivered, documents said.
